In March and April, tree pollen fills the air. People notice yellow dust on cars and buildings. Trees like birch and oak release a lot of pollen.

Summer is a busy time for grass and weed pollen. June and July are peak months. Fields and meadows grow tall grass and colorful flowers.

In autumn, some plants release pollen too. September and October have less pollen than spring and summer. But some trees still produce pollen in Zawoja.

Annual Pollen Overview

Check out this month-by-month overview of the daily average pollen count in Zawoja 🌾. This data is based on previous years and serves as a guideline to help you understand when different pollen seasons typically occur in your city.

  Alder Birch Grass Mugwort Olive Ragweed
Jan 2.7 0 0 0 0 0
Feb 5.4 0 0 0 0 0
Mar 943.7 58.6 0 0 0 0
Apr 5.6 3721.1 13.4 0 0.5 0
May 0.2 209 100.5 0 0.1 0
Jun 0 4.7 643.4 0.1 4.9 0
Jul 0 0.4 245.2 14.8 0 0
Aug 0 0 70 33.8 0 67
Sep 0 0 6.3 12.9 0 76.4
Oct 0 0 0.4 0.4 0 0
Nov 0 0 0 0 0 0
Dec 0 0 0 0 0 0
